Preventive Maintenance at General Aviation Airports is published as a two-volume set. Volume 1 is a primer for airport governing- and policy-board members on the importance and value of a preventive maintenance (PM) program. Volume 2 is a guidebook for airport managers, maintenance managers, and all line personnel on how to plan, prioritize, and conduct preventive maintenance for physical infrastructure assets. This Volume 1 Primer begins by discussing the value of airports to communities and the national airspace system. It reviews the various infrastructure assets at airports and outlines the value of planning and prioritizing preventive maintenance into the budgeting process and the impacts to operations if an airport fails to conduct preventive maintenance. It also identifies basic principles for establishing and implementing a preventive maintenance program.
